JFCCT Prime Minister’s Address Luncheon 2026

The Irish-Thai Chamber of Commerce (ITCC) was pleased to participate in the JFCCT Prime Minister’s Address Luncheon 2026, held on 12 June 2026 at The Athenee Hotel Bangkok.
Representing ITCC at the event was Paul Scales, Vice President of ITCC, joined by Shane Rice, Deputy Head of Mission at the Embassy of Ireland in Thailand, and ITCC members representing a diverse range of business sectors and industries.
Hosted by the Joint Foreign Chambers of Commerce in Thailand (JFCCT), the luncheon brought together more than 400 business leaders, investors, diplomats, and representatives of the international business community under the theme:
“Thailand 2026: A Vision for Competitiveness, Investment, and a Future-Ready Economy – From Uncertainty to Confidence: Reform and Resilience in Business.”
In his keynote address, Prime Minister Anutin Charnvirakul outlined the Government’s commitment to strengthening investor confidence and enhancing Thailand’s competitiveness through regulatory reform, streamlined processes, digital transformation, and a more business-friendly environment. He also highlighted Thailand’s ambitions to attract investment in strategic growth sectors, including artificial intelligence, semiconductors, advanced technologies, clean energy, and other future industries.
The Prime Minister further emphasised the importance of public-private collaboration, infrastructure development, workforce upskilling, sustainability initiatives, and innovation as key drivers of Thailand’s long-term economic growth and competitiveness.
